Safer Cleaning Products for People and Surfaces
Match the cleaner to the soil and material
Dirt, grease, mineral deposits, stains, odors, and microorganisms habit stand-in treatment. A sexless or material-specific cleaner often works best on delicate surfaces. Acidic products can etch acid-sensitive stone, while abrasive pads may unexciting polished finishes or separate protective coatings.
A mighty odor does not prove that a product works better. test an peculiar cleaner on a hidden area first, subsequently check for color change, clouding, swelling, or residue. Blot liquids on rug and fabric on the other hand of rubbing them deeper into the fibers.
Disinfect on your own following the business calls for it
Cleaning removes dirt and many germs from a surface. Disinfecting uses a product intended to kill determined microorganisms, but it works only bearing in mind used as the label directs. Illness, bodily-fluid contamination, food-preparation surfaces, and frequently touched areas may call for disinfection.
Read the required entre time, which is how long the surface must stay visibly wet. Check surface compatibility, provide ventilation, and increase the product safely. suggestion from the U.S. Environmental protection Agency and the Centers for sickness govern and Prevention can encourage you choose satisfactory products and methods.
Never combination bleach subsequently ammonia, acids, or extra cleaners. keep products in their native labeled containers, away from children, pets, and food. Wear gloves, eye protection, or a mask or respirator with the label or a workplace hazard assessment requires it. Use sever cloths for bathrooms and kitchens, performance from cleaner areas toward dirtier ones, and wash your hands after removing gloves.

Solve Stains, Odors, and Contamination Safely
Treat stains by source and surface
Identify the substance previously choosing a treatment. Grease, protein-based stains, tannins, rust, ink, and mineral deposits each answer to every second methods. Avoid heat or unfriendly chemicals until you know the stain type and have checked the material's care requirements.
In a rental or client property, photograph unfamiliar or persistent stains before intensive treatment. Some marks arrive from damaged finishes, out of date leaks, or surviving discoloration rather than removable dirt. A cleaning professional should compilation later a stain cannot be corrected without fix or replacement.
Remove smell sources otherwise of masking them
Fragrance may conceal an smell for a quick time, but it does not cut off the cause. Check garbage containers, drains, textiles, upholstery, carpets, appliances, and damp hidden areas. sever impure materials considering appropriate, tidy the affected surfaces, enhance airflow, and true moisture problems.
Persistent smoke, sewage, pet, or mildew odors may tapering off to a plumbing, building, or moisture issue. Homeowners should arrange a proper inspection, even though tenants should notify the landlord or property superintendent promptly. keep old photographs and copies of messages virtually the problem.
Extensive mold-like growth, pest contamination, heavily soiled materials, and suspected hazardous substances may obsession ascribed help. complete not distress them without proper training and equipment. Fixing leaks, condensation, and needy airing remains valuable because cleaning alone cannot solve an ongoing moisture source.
